package api
import (
"fmt"
"github.com/TicketsBot/GoPanel/botcontext"
"github.com/TicketsBot/GoPanel/database"
"github.com/TicketsBot/GoPanel/rpc/cache"
"github.com/TicketsBot/GoPanel/utils"
"github.com/gin-gonic/gin"
"github.com/rxdn/gdl/rest"
"regexp"
"strconv"
"strings"
)
var MentionRegex, _ = regexp.Compile("<@(\\d+)>")
func GetTicket(ctx *gin.Context) {
guildId := ctx.Keys["guildid"].(uint64)
botContext, err := botcontext.ContextForGuild(guildId)
if err != nil {
ctx.AbortWithStatusJSON(500, gin.H{
"success": false,
"error": err.Error(),
})
return
}
ticketId, err := strconv.Atoi(ctx.Param("ticketId"))
if err != nil {
ctx.AbortWithStatusJSON(400, gin.H{
"success": true,
"error": "Invalid ticket ID",
})
return
}
// Get the ticket struct
ticket, err := database.Client.Tickets.Get(ticketId, guildId)
if err != nil {
ctx.AbortWithStatusJSON(500, gin.H{
"success": true,
"error": err.Error(),
})
return
}
if ticket.GuildId != guildId {
ctx.AbortWithStatusJSON(403, gin.H{
"success": false,
"error": "Guild ID doesn't match",
})
return
}
if !ticket.Open {
ctx.AbortWithStatusJSON(404, gin.H{
"success": false,
"error": "Ticket does not exist",
})
return
}
if ticket.ChannelId == nil {
ctx.AbortWithStatusJSON(404, gin.H{
"success": false,
"error": "Ticket channel does not exist",
})
return
}
// Get messages
messages, _ := rest.GetChannelMessages(botContext.Token, botContext.RateLimiter, *ticket.ChannelId, rest.GetChannelMessagesData{Limit: 100})
// Format messages, exclude unneeded data
messagesFormatted := make([]map[string]interface{}, 0)
for _, message := range utils.Reverse(messages) {
content := message.Content
// Format mentions properly
match := MentionRegex.FindAllStringSubmatch(content, -1)
for _, mention := range match {
if len(mention) >= 2 {
mentionedId, err := strconv.ParseUint(mention[1], 10, 64)
if err != nil {
continue
}
user, _ := cache.Instance.GetUser(mentionedId)
content = strings.ReplaceAll(content, fmt.Sprintf("<@%d>", mentionedId), fmt.Sprintf("@%s", user.Username))
}
}
messagesFormatted = append(messagesFormatted, map[string]interface{}{
"username": message.Author.Username,
"content": content,
})
}
ctx.JSON(200, gin.H{
"success": true,
"ticket": ticket,
"messages": messagesFormatted,
})
}
